A home business is a real business, so don't go charging in without a business plan. This plan may change significantly over time, and you may even decide to disregard it altogether. But having a business plan gives you the discipline to follow your initial ideas and serves as a tangible reminder of what you want to accomplish. Update the plan periodically.

It is important to keep track of your daily spending since these have a direct effect on the business you operate. This will come in very helpful when it comes tax time, or if you face an audit by the IRS.
Make sure that if you have a home day care business, you get help from another adult if you need it. Without sufficient staff, you will have difficulty caring for the children properly and providing for their basic needs, such as making sure they eat, take a nap, behave appropriately and other basic tasks.
When you work at home, it is quite easy to let work take over your life. You should separate your work and personal life by establishing a specific work zone, as well as setting clear work hours to leave time for your personal life.

As a home business owner, you should keep track of your mileage, gas consumption, and auto repairs related to your business. Owning a business means your tax situation can dramatically change and you will be able to get deductions for transportation costs related to your business. This type of tax deduction could be very substantial if your business requires a lot of travel.
Keep your business contracts organized so they are easy to find. Keep a separate folder in your files where you can place other contracts until you need them, such as with your phone company or internet service, so they're handy if you need to review them.
